Usual Paint Obstacles Homeowners Address

Many homeowners face various difficulties when it comes to painting their rooms. One ongoing issue is choosing the appropriate shade; with countless shades on offer, many struggle to imagine how a color will appear in their home. Preparing surfaces is another critical hurdle; insufficient washing or priming can result in peeling and uneven coatings. Furthermore, homeowners often underestimate the quantity of product required, causing several trips to the store or excess remaining paint. What to Expect From the Painting Process?

Comprehending the painting process can reduce some of the frustrations homeowners encounter during their projects. The progression typically commences with a meeting, where professionals evaluate the space and review color options. Subsequently, the group prepares the space by moving furniture, protecting them, and addressing any damage to the walls. Base coat application may happen, especially for newly repaired or fresh areas, providing better paint adhesion.

After planning are complete, painters apply the designated paint using effective techniques to ensure a smooth finish. Homeowners should anticipate a several-layer application for ideal color depth and durability. Communication during the process is essential; painters frequently provide updates and address any concerns. Lastly, the project concludes with a detailed clean-up, restoring the space to its original state. Understanding these steps can empower homeowners, setting reasonable expectations for a successful painting experience.

Important Paint Application Methods for a Flawless Result

To achieve a flawless finish in house painting, one must excel in crucial techniques that raise the overall standard of the work. Proper surface preparation is necessary, including rigorous cleaning, sanding, and priming to guarantee the paint sticks properly. This process prevents problems like peeling and bubbling in the future.

Premium brushes and rollers greatly impact the final appearance; the right equipment minimize streaks and ensure consistent coverage. Adopting a systematic method, such as working in stages and maintaining a wet edge, helps eliminate visible lines and imperfections.

Additionally, applying several thin coats instead of a one thick layer boosts durability and richness of color. Attention to detail, particularly when cutting in around edges and trim, further contributes to a professional look. By using these practices, homeowners can produce a remarkable finish that transforms their space and reflects the expertise of professional painters.

Finding the Best Colors for Your Home

How might homeowners determine the ideal colors for their living spaces? A mindful technique encompasses understanding the mood and atmosphere they wish to create. Warm tones, like reds and oranges, can energize spaces, while cool colors such as blues and greens promote peace. Observing the natural light in each room is important; shades can appear different depending on the luminosity and orientation of the light.

Homeowners should also take into account current furnishings and decor, ensuring a harmonious look throughout the home. Utilizing color samples or examples can help imagine how chosen tones will interact with the overall space. Additionally, exploring color principles can provide insights into complementary and contrasting colors, enhancing aesthetic appeal.

Ultimately, individual tastes should guide decisions, as the chosen palette will showcase the homeowner's aesthetic and personality. By harmonizing these factors, choosing ideal hues becomes an enjoyable and fulfilling experience.

Tips for Preserving Your Freshly Painted Surfaces

Keeping freshly painted surfaces in optimal shape requires close care to guarantee they stay vibrant and intact. Regular cleaning is crucial; using a soft cloth and gentle cleanser can help remove dirt and marks without damaging the coating. It is recommended to avoid abrasive cleaners that may scratch or dull the finish.

Furthermore, homeowners should keep an eye out for signs of wear, like peeling and fading, and fix these issues immediately to stop additional deterioration. Putting on a protective coating can improve longevity, especially in busy zones.

Temperature and humidity also contribute to preserving additional information painted surfaces; keeping indoor environments consistent can minimize fluctuations that weaken the paint. Finally, it is beneficial to avoid subjecting painted surfaces to direct sunlight for prolonged periods, as UV rays can cause colors to discolor. By following these tips, individuals can enjoy their freshly painted spaces for years to come.

Finding and Hiring Top House Painting Professionals

When in search of top house painters, homeowners often wonder what benchmarks to take into consideration in their search. First, they should assess experience and expertise. Painters with a proven portfolio and positive reviews often show a notable level of workmanship. Additionally, verifying credentials, including licensing and insurance, is necessary to guarantee compliance with local regulations and protection against potential liabilities.

Next, homeowners may ask for suggestions from acquaintances or online platforms to assess reliability and customer satisfaction. It’s also advisable to obtain several quotes; this allows for evaluation of pricing and services provided. Clear dialogue regarding project timelines and materials is essential for establishing expectations.

Ultimately, a competent painter should present a signed agreement laying out all details, promoting openness and responsibility. By prioritizing these key factors, property owners can assuredly opt for experienced professionals who will transform their domestic spaces.

How Long Will the Coating Endure Prior to Requiring a Refresh?

Typically, premium paint remains between five to seven years before needing touch-ups. Variables such as weather exposure, substrate prep, and paint formula can affect durability, affecting how soon maintenance might be needed.

Can I Stay in My Home During the Painting Process?

Yes, homeowners can typically remain in their dwellings during the painting process. However, it's advisable to stay away from newly painted areas to prevent inhalation of fumes and enable the paint to set correctly for best outcomes.

Which Category of Paint Is Ideal for High-Moisture Regions?

For wet locations such as bathrooms and kitchens, acrylic or latex paint featuring mold prevention works well. These paints provide robustness, effortless cleaning, and prevent mold growth, ensuring sustained performance in humid settings.

Can You Find Environmentally Friendly Paints for Home Use?

Yes, eco-conscious coatings are accessible for residential applications. These paints, often designated as low-VOC or zero-VOC, minimize toxic fumes and are made from natural ingredients, providing safer options for both occupants and the environment.

How Do Weather-based Changes Affect Painting Jobs?

Seasonal shifts greatly influence painting projects, as temperature and humidity levels determine paint adhesion and drying times. Spring and fall offer ideal conditions, while extreme heat or cold can produce poor results and prolonged project durations.
